As extra docs and sufferers flip to the most recent weight-loss medicine, researchers are attempting to determine which drug is correct for which affected person—and at what level of their weight-loss journey.
Key to creating these choices is how efficient the medicine are and which unwanted side effects individuals may expertise whereas taking them.
A brand new research revealed within the New England Journal of Drugs and introduced on the European Congress on Weight problems supplies a few of these solutions. Researchers report on a head-to-head trial evaluating Wegovy (semaglutide), made by Novo Nordisk, to Zepbound (tirzepatide), made by Eil Lilly. The preliminary findings had been launched in Dec. by Eli Lilly, who funded the research. The present report contains extra particulars on how the 2 medicine affected waist circumference and different measures, in addition to their unwanted side effects.
Among the many 751 individuals randomly assigned to obtain weekly injections of both the utmost dose of Wegovy or the utmost dose of Zepbound for a yr and three months, these taking Zepbound misplaced extra of their preliminary physique weight—20.2%—than these taking Wegovy, who misplaced 13.7%. The Zepbound group misplaced about 18.4 cm of their waist circumference, in comparison with 13.0 cm amongst these taking Wegovy.
The medicines had comparable unwanted side effects, primarily regarding gastrointestinal signs together with nausea, constipation, diarrhea, and vomiting. Nonetheless, these taking Zepbound reported extra injection-site reactions than individuals getting Wegovy. These tended to turn out to be much less frequent with extra weekly injections.

“The concept right here is that we didn’t have choices earlier than—or we had very unhealthy choices—and now we now have higher and higher therapies, and they’re completely different,” says Dr. Leonard Glass, senior vp of worldwide medical affairs for Lilly’s cardiometabolic well being enterprise, and one of many co-authors of the research.
Whereas the first goal for these remedy is weight reduction, it’s not the one metric by which the medicine must be evaluated and prescribed. Glass factors out that weight problems is a fancy situation, and other people with weight problems usually produce other well being points as properly, associated to the guts, kidney, and liver. “It’s not nearly weight,” he says.
Dr. Jason Brett, principal U.S. medical head for Novo Nordisk, which makes Wegovy, agrees that weight shouldn’t be the one end result that docs and sufferers ought to think about when evaluating the 2 medicines. He notes that Wegovy—not like its competitor—is authorized by the U.S. Meals and Drug Administration to scale back the chance of coronary heart assault, stroke, and coronary heart illness in individuals with a historical past of coronary heart issues who’re obese or overweight. “Once I take into consideration what makes semaglutide and Wegovy distinctive, it’s the breadth and depth of knowledge behind it,” he says. “We’re speaking about going past weight reduction alone to a few of these different well being outcomes.”
Zepbound doesn’t embody a heart-disease indication, however research have proven that Zepbound, in addition to Wegovy, can cut back the chance of coronary heart failure in some sufferers with the situation. Research are additionally displaying that the medicine can cut back the chance of liver and kidney signs as properly. And Zepbound is authorized to scale back the chance of obstructive sleep apnea in individuals with weight problems.
The present findings ought to assist docs higher perceive which drug could be proper for which affected person. Extra research that each firms are conducting—together with these following individuals as soon as they’ve reached their weight-loss targets—must also present extra knowledge on how these medicine may assist individuals keep a wholesome weight. Each Lilly and Novo Nordisk additionally plan to have oral variations of their injectable medicine accessible quickly. Novo Nordisk introduced it had requested FDA approval for its oral semaglutide in Might, and Lilly expects to have outcomes from its last trials in a number of months; if these are constructive, it plans to use for approval quickly after. Oral variations of those medicine may attain extra individuals who may profit from them, and the capsules is also thought-about a part of upkeep remedy relying on their particular person wants. “Proper now, [those decisions] are based mostly on doctor expertise, and generally not essentially on one of the best proof,” says Glass. “We are attempting to offer that proof so docs and sufferers can higher make these choices.”
